Highlights
Are people in Kirkland older or younger than people in Easton?
- The Median Age in Kirkland is 18.4 years younger than in Easton.

Are housing costs cheaper in Kirkland or Easton?
- Kirkland housing costs are 104.9% more expensive than Easton hous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, Kirkland or Easton?
- The average commute for residents of Kirkland is 6.2 minutes longer than it is for residents of Easton.

Things to do in Easton?
Easton, WA is a small rural town nestled in the Cascade Mountains. It is surrounded by lush green forests and snow-capped mountains that provide an amazing backdrop for outdoor activities like hiking, camping, fishing, and skiing. The community is close-knit and friendly, with strong ties to the local agricultural industry. Despite its size, Easton offers plenty of amenities such as shops, restaurants, schools, libraries, parks, and more. Residents enjoy the peaceful atmosphere in Easton while still having access to all of the larger cities nearby. It's a great place to live if you're looking for a comfortable and leisurely lifestyle.
